Output 8d15b761c307a546fd3da5fa89f73a66e870312fd3cc8706694e6c1da656529e:0

value
29041
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d7b208fea79a3b77ac61d661dc7f132ebdfdc6b8 OP_EQUAL
address
3MMWUtJhAnz5AcuVGRag8CHVFFzF6zm95d
transaction
8d15b761c307a546fd3da5fa89f73a66e870312fd3cc8706694e6c1da656529e